Transaction 7b529a08f6fabca6214c90dd9f567f5919281e85b6b5a69a8867de96fbf9fc40
1 Input
1 Output
-
7b529a08f6fabca6214c90dd9f567f5919281e85b6b5a69a8867de96fbf9fc40:0
- value
- 20349544
- script pubkey
- OP_0 OP_PUSHBYTES_20 0242054b79a548b31619bcb74a5d9838e4fe34c9
- address
- bc1qqfpq2jme54ytx9sehjm55hvc8rj0udxf9pll5f